[Postfixbuch-users] Versenden über Postfix dauert zu lange
Sandy Drobic
postfixbuch-users at japantest.homelinux.com
Do Nov 9 13:03:36 CET 2006
Holm Kapschitzki wrote:
> Hallo,
>
> ich habe ein Debian System mit Cyrus und Postfix. Versende ich hier mit
> Thunderbird über Windows Mails, dabei ist es egal ob hinter dsl
> router/firewall oder probehalber mit isdn eingewählt braucht mein Mail
> Client ca 10 Sekunden um eine Mail zu versenden. Ich dachte zuerst das
> liegt am Spamassassin, der ist nämlich so eingebunden:
>
> smtp inet n - n - - smtpd -o
> content_filter=spamassassin:
>
> # spamd
> spamassassin unix - n n - - pipe
> user=nobody argv=/usr/bin/spamc -u ${user} -f -e
> /usr/sbin/sendmail -oi -f ${sender} -- ${recipient}
>
> Jedenfalls prüft der auch Mails die verendet werden. Das abzustellen
> wäre aber eine andere Frage. Jedenfalls hab ich den SA deaktiviert und
> immer noch das Gleiche Problem. Meine logs sind auch nicht besonders
> aufschlussreich:
>
> Nov 9 10:54:34 srv4 postfix/smtpd[28446]: connect from
> p54BCFExx.dip.t-dialin.net[84.188.254.xx]
> Nov 9 10:54:34 srv4 postfix/smtpd[28446]: setting up TLS connection
> from p54BCFExx.dip.t-dialin.net[84.188.254.xx]
> Nov 9 10:54:35 srv4 postfix/smtpd[28446]: TLS connection established
> from p54BCFExx.dip.t-dialin.net[84.188.254.xx]: TLSv1 with cipher
> DHE-RSA-AES256-SHA (256/256 bits)
Okay, eine Sekunde für den TLS-Aufbau. Nicht berühmt, geht aber.
> Nov 9 10:54:35 srv4 postfix/smtpd[28446]: 7F6E6A48200:
> client=p54BCFExx.dip.t-dialin.net[84.188.254.xx], sasl_method=PLAIN,
> sasl_username=web3p1
> Nov 9 10:54:35 srv4 postfix/cleanup[28458]: 7F6E6A48200:
> message-id=<4552FA99.3000900 at xxxxx.de>
> Nov 9 10:54:35 srv4 postfix/qmgr[26480]: 7F6E6A48200: from=<xx at xx.de>,
> size=809, nrcpt=1 (queue active)
> Nov 9 10:54:35 srv4 postfix/smtpd[28446]: disconnect from
> p54BCFExx.dip.t-dialin.net[84.188.254.xx
Die Mail wurde eingeliefert, auch innerhalb einer Sekunde. Ist in Ordnung.
> Nov 9 10:55:06 srv4 postfix/smtp[28459]: 7F6E6A48200: to=<xx at xx.net>,
> relay=mx01.xx.com[85.14.218.xx], delay=31, status=sent (250 Message queued)
> Nov 9 10:55:06 srv4 postfix/qmgr[26480]: 7F6E6A48200: removed
Hier gibt es jetzt eine Verzögerung von 30 Sekunden. Das spricht für
DNS-Timeouts bei Spamassassin. Irgendwelche eingestellten Tests fragen
einen DNS-Server ab, der nicht reagiert. Das ist meine erste Vermutung.
Prüfe bitte, was spamc in sein Log schreibt. Prüfe alle DNS-RBLs, die
Spamc befragt.
> An welchen Parametern muss man schreiben, bzw was für Infos werden noch
> benötigt, um dem Problem auf die Spur zu kommen?
> Der Server ist eigentlich nicht überlastet. CPU/Speicher und gesunder
> Load stehen zur Verfügung. Mailverkehr durchschnittlich/ alle 2 Sekunde
> eine.
Das Problem liegt, so wie ich es hier sehe, bei Spamc. Schraube da mal den
Loglevel hoch und schau nach, welche Abfragen in einen Timeout laufen.
Sandy
--
Antworten bitte nur in die Mailingliste!
PMs bitte an: news-reply2 (@) japantest (.) homelinux (.) com
Mehr Informationen über die Mailingliste Postfixbuch-users